Transaction 31ed39498b4f6def9d9e902a366c356394dc4f543203c26c240050ed77e299e4

1 Input
2 Outputs
  • 31ed39498b4f6def9d9e902a366c356394dc4f543203c26c240050ed77e299e4:0
  • value  2500000
    address  3CPadyBQtKDqcnZhRunc4bq5GWrLrCesae
  • 31ed39498b4f6def9d9e902a366c356394dc4f543203c26c240050ed77e299e4:1
  • value  120763
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N